What Is Rimfire Rifles

Understanding the Mechanics of Rimfire Technology

The world of ballistics is often divided into two primary ignition systems: centerfire and rimfire. Understanding the rimfire platform is essential for any shooting enthusiast, as it represents a unique intersection of engineering efficiency and historical utility. At its core, a rimfire rifle is a firearm that uses a cartridge where the priming compound—the chemical mixture responsible for igniting the propellant—is contained entirely within the hollow, folded rim of the cartridge casing.

The Anatomy of a Rimfire Cartridge

Unlike centerfire cartridges, which feature a distinct, replaceable primer cup seated in the center of the cartridge base, the rimfire design integrates the ignition source into the casing itself. During the manufacturing process, the priming compound is spun into the rim of the cartridge. When the shooter pulls the trigger, the firing pin strikes the rim of the casing, crushing it against the rear face of the barrel. This impact ignites the primer, which in turn ignites the main powder charge, propelling the bullet forward.

Advantages of the Rimfire Design

The primary advantage of the rimfire system is cost-effectiveness. Because the primer is an integral part of the case, the manufacturing process is significantly streamlined. This translates to lower production costs, making rimfire ammunition, such as the ubiquitous .22 Long Rifle (LR), one of the most affordable options on the market. Additionally, rimfire rifles are characterized by their simplicity and reliability. Without the need for a complex centerfire firing mechanism, rimfire actions can be made lighter and more compact, making them ideal for training, target practice, and small-game hunting.

Evolutionary History and Modern Applications

The development of the rimfire cartridge in the mid-19th century revolutionized the firearm industry by enabling the mass production of self-contained metallic cartridges. While centerfire cartridges eventually became the standard for high-power military and sporting rifles due to their ability to withstand higher internal pressures, the rimfire platform never lost its relevance.

From Flobert to the .22 LR

The history of rimfire began with Louis-Nicolas Flobert’s “bullet breech” caps in 1845, which were essentially percussion caps with a bullet attached. Over the decades, this evolved into the modern rimfire cartridges we recognize today. The .22 LR, introduced in 1887, remains the most popular cartridge in history. Its longevity is a testament to its design; it is accurate enough for competitive target shooting, powerful enough for small game hunting, and gentle enough for teaching novices the fundamentals of marksmanship.

Contemporary Use Cases

In the modern era, rimfire rifles serve several specific roles. They are the gold standard for introductory marksmanship. The low recoil and minimal noise signature allow new shooters to focus on trigger control, sight alignment, and breathing without the flinch-inducing impact of high-caliber rifles. Furthermore, the precision rimfire market has seen a resurgence. Competitive disciplines like the Precision Rifle Series (PRS) now feature dedicated rimfire divisions, where shooters utilize highly specialized, match-grade rimfire rifles to engage targets at extended distances, testing their ability to account for ballistics and wind drift in a format that mirrors long-range centerfire competition.

Technical Specifications and Performance Considerations

Selecting a rimfire rifle requires a nuanced understanding of how these firearms perform under various conditions. While they are often viewed as simple “plinkers,” modern rimfire rifles can be highly sophisticated machines, featuring match-grade barrels, adjustable triggers, and precision-engineered actions.

Accuracy and Barrel Harmonics

Because rimfire ammunition operates at relatively low pressures, the barrel’s interaction with the projectile is critical. Barrel harmonics—the vibrations that travel through the metal when a shot is fired—have a profound impact on accuracy. Many high-end rimfire rifles are equipped with heavy, free-floated barrels that minimize these vibrations, allowing for consistent shot-to-shot placement. Furthermore, the rifling twist rate must be precisely matched to the weight of the bullets being fired; for instance, standard .22 LR cartridges perform best with a specific twist rate to ensure stable flight over distances exceeding 100 yards.

Action Types in Rimfire Rifles

The versatility of rimfire rifles is largely defined by the action type:

  • Bolt-Action: Regarded as the pinnacle of rimfire accuracy, bolt-action rifles provide a rigid lock-up and consistent ignition, making them the preferred choice for target shooters and hunters.
  • Semi-Automatic: These rifles use the energy from each shot to cycle the action and load the next round. They are popular for recreational shooting and field use where follow-up shots are required quickly.
  • Lever-Action: Evoking a classic Western aesthetic, lever-action rimfires are beloved for their manual operation and rapid-fire potential, offering a unique blend of heritage and function.

Maintenance and Safety Protocols

As with any mechanical device, the performance and longevity of a rimfire rifle depend on proper maintenance. Because rimfire ammunition often utilizes lead bullets and non-jacketed projectiles, these rifles tend to accumulate lead fouling within the barrel.

Cleaning and Care

Routine cleaning is essential to maintain accuracy. Lead buildup can degrade the rifling’s effectiveness, leading to unpredictable shot groups. Shooters should utilize a high-quality bore solvent and cleaning rod, moving from the breech to the muzzle to protect the crown of the barrel—the most critical part of the rifle for precision. Additionally, keeping the action free of debris is vital. Unburnt powder and carbon can accumulate in the receiver, leading to feed failures or light primer strikes.

Safe Handling Practices

Despite their smaller stature and lower power, rimfire rifles are fully functional firearms and must be treated with the same safety standards as high-powered centerfire weapons. The “four rules” of firearm safety remain the foundation: treat every rifle as if it is loaded; never point the muzzle at anything you are not prepared to destroy; keep your finger off the trigger until your sights are on target; and be certain of your target and what lies beyond it. Furthermore, because rimfire ammunition can travel significant distances, backstops must be constructed of appropriate materials—such as thick berms or engineered bullet traps—to prevent ricochets and ensure that every projectile is safely contained.

The Future of Rimfire Shooting

The rimfire category is currently experiencing a renaissance, driven by technological advancements in ammunition manufacturing and the increasing popularity of precision shooting sports. While the .22 LR remains king, cartridges like the .17 HMR (Hornady Magnum Rimfire) and the .22 WMR (Winchester Magnum Rimfire) have expanded the capabilities of the platform.

Innovations in Ammunition

Modern rimfire ammunition is more consistent than ever. Match-grade offerings now utilize proprietary bullet coatings and precise powder measures, reducing velocity variations that were once common in mass-produced rimfire rounds. These advancements allow shooters to extend their effective range, making 200- or even 300-yard shots a reality for the skilled rimfire marksman.
